About the role

View original

As a Software Architect at SES, you will play a key role in the design, development, and validation of high-quality software, integrating software expertise with a deep understanding of satellite systems. You should thrive in a high-pace environment, enjoy tackling complex problems, and bring creativity to every solution. Collaboration and teamwork are essential to you, and you value helping others succeed. Key Responsibilities: - Work with demand management team to design & develop features to meet product requirements - Implement and maintain the software architecture of high-quality software throughout the software development lifecycle - Interface with internal stakeholders to define software requirements - Propose innovative methods to enhance existing software architecture - Stay updated on new technologies and assess their relevance for SES - Lead the technical section for external bids - Present solutions for issues in a coherent manner considering system needs - Guide team members in testing and maintaining the existing code base - Drive system integration and validation through test plan preparation and review - Engage in peer reviews to ensure code quality and contribute to codebase improvement - Provide expertise for anomaly resolution and propose corrective/preventive actions - Demonstrate developed solutions to stakeholders and customers - Onboard, train, and mentor new team members - Share information and knowledge with other teams for effective communication - Participate in knowledge-sharing sessions to create a collaborative environment - Maintain technical documentation for future reference Qualifications: - Bachelor or Masters deg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Telecommunication, or Electrical Engineering - 10+ years of experience in designing, developing, and testing software for critical systems - Experience in telecommunication satellites systems - Strong programming skills in C#, ASP.NET MVC/.NET Core, and IIS-based web application architecture - Experience with Oracle database design and PL/SQL - Hands-on experience with front end design using JS and React - Familiarity with Continuous Integration/Continuous Deployment (CI/CD) tools, preferably Azure DevOps - Understanding of cloud orchestration tools, technologies, and API standards - Previous experience with inventory management systems By fostering collaboration, excellence, and inclusivity, SES provides fair and equal employment opportunities to all qualified applicants without discrimination based on various factors.
